About Asunción

Asunción, Paraguay's capital city, is a charming destination waiting to be discovered. As one of South America's most historic cities, Asunción offers visitors a rich blend of local culture, historic landmarks, and natural beauty. From exploring historical sites like the Casa de la Independencia and the Palacio de López to immersing yourself in the vibrant arts and music scenes, there's something for everyone.

Don't miss the opportunity to experience the local gastronomy, with dishes like milanesa and grilled meats being local staples. The city also offers tax-free shopping opportunities, with various malls and shopping streets to explore. Whether you're interested in history, culture, nature, or shopping, Asunción has plenty to offer, promising a memorable travel experience.

Asunción FAQ

What are some must-visit historical landmarks in Asunción?

The Casa de la Independencia, a historic mansion and museum, is a must-visit. Also, explore the Palacio de López, the Presidential Palace, a stunning example of neoclassical architecture. The Panteón de los Héroes is another important site, a monument dedicated to national heroes.

What cultural attractions can I find in Asunción?

Asunción has a vibrant arts and music scene. Visit the Panteón de los Héroes, the Museo del Barro for indigenous arts, and the Teatro Municipal Ignacio A. Pane for musical performances. The city's cultural offerings are diverse and engaging.

What are some local dishes I should try in Asunción?

Be sure to try the milanesa with papas fritas, a local favorite. Also, explore the restaurants along the riverfront for grilled meats served with chimichurri sauce. These dishes offer a true taste of Paraguayan cuisine.
